Overview

EVAL-AD5590EBZ from Analog Devices is a USB-enabled evaluation board for the AD5590 16-channel, 12-bit multichannel I/O port IC. It supports standalone microcontroller/DSP control via 20-pin J1 header and provides full register access to DACs, ADCs, internal references, and power management features. Designed for rapid prototyping of mixed-signal industrial and instrumentation systems.

Technical Context

The EVAL-AD5590EBZ implements a complete test platform for the AD5590BBCZ, integrating CY7C68013A-56LFXC USB microcontroller for PC communication and SN74HC245PWR bus transceivers for level-shifting. It supports dual internal 2.5 V references (VREFIN1/VREFOUT1 and VREFIN2/VREFOUT2), selectable via LK16, and provides independent analog input (VIN0–VIN15) and output (VOUT0–VOUT15) test points with series grounding links.

Power architecture includes four dedicated 5 V supply connectors (J3–J6), configurable via six solder-jumpers (LK33–LK37) to consolidate supplies or enable USB-only operation (LK35 in Positions A+B). Standalone mode disables USB interface signals by removing LK38 and routes DSYNC1/DSYNC2, DSCLK, DDIN, LDAC, CLR, ASCLK, ASYNC, ADIN, and ADOUT through J1.

Key Specifications

Parameter Value and Actual Design Meaning
Target Device AD5590BBCZ - 16-channel, 12-bit, multichannel I/O port with integrated ADCs, DACs, and references
Interface Options USB 2.0 (via CY7C68013A) or parallel digital interface (20-pin J1 header with DSYNC/DSCLK/DDIN/ASCLK/ADIN/ADOUT)
Reference Support Dual internal 2.5 V references; external reference selectable via VREF SMB jack and LK16 position A
Analog Access 16 differential analog inputs (VIN0± to VIN15±) and 16 single-ended outputs (VOUT0 to VOUT15), each with series grounding link
Power Flexibility Configurable via 6 solder jumpers (LK33–LK37); supports USB-only operation (LK35 A+B) or multi-rail external supplies (J3–J6)
Software Control PC software with tabbed DAC0–DAC7/DAC8–DAC15/ADC/Misc interface; supports register programming, ADC readback, and DAC loading

FAQ

What is the primary function of the EVAL-AD5590EBZ?

The EVAL-AD5590EBZ is a dedicated evaluation board for the AD5590BBCZ multichannel I/O port IC. It enables functional verification and performance characterization of all 16 DAC channels, 16 ADC channels, internal references, and digital interface timing. The board is not intended for production use but serves as a validated hardware platform for lab-based design exploration and firmware development targeting the AD5590.

Can the EVAL-AD5590EBZ operate without a PC connection?

Yes, the EVAL-AD5590EBZ supports standalone operation. By removing jumper LK38 and configuring power links (LK33–LK37 per Table 3), the board isolates the USB interface and exposes the AD5590's native parallel digital interface on 20-pin header J1. This allows direct control from an external DSP or microcontroller using signals including DSYNC1/DSYNC2, DSCLK, DDIN, LDAC, CLR, ASCLK, ASYNC, ADIN, and ADOUT - as defined in Table 5 of the board documentation.

How are reference voltages selected on the EVAL-AD5590EBZ?

Reference selection is controlled by 3-position jumper LK16. Position B connects VREFIN1/VREFOUT1 to VREFA; Position C connects VREFIN2/VREFOUT2 to VREFA; Position A selects an external reference applied to the VREF SMB jack. Both internal references are 2.5 V ± 0.5%, and only one should be enabled at a time when linked together to avoid contention - a constraint explicitly noted in the software section regarding simultaneous reference activation.

What power supply configurations does the EVAL-AD5590EBZ support?

The EVAL-AD5590EBZ accepts up to four independent 5 V supplies via connectors J3 (AMP0–AMP3), J4 (AMP4–AMP7), J5 (ADC/DAC core), and J6 (VDRIVE). Power grouping is achieved using solder jumpers LK33–LK37: LK35 in both Positions A and B enables full USB-only operation; LK36 connects V2− to AGND for single-supply op amp use; LK37 selects AVDD or external source for VDRIVE. Configuration details are documented in Tables 1–3 of the board user guide.

Does the EVAL-AD5590EBZ include software, and what functions does it provide?

Yes, the EVAL-AD5590EBZ ships with PC software (distributed on CD) that communicates via USB to program AD5590 registers, read all 16 ADC channels, and write to all 16 DAC channels. The GUI features tabbed interfaces for DAC blocks (0–7 and 8–15), ADC configuration (input range, ADOUT weak/three-state), and Misc controls (LDAC/CLR state, raw register writes). It also supports saving 512 ADC samples per channel to file, though sample timing depends on Windows OS scheduling.
